Seabourn 2022-2023 Deployment Breakdown

Seabourn Venture

With its six luxury ships sailing globally, Seabourn’s winter program is highlighted by the new Seabourn Venture which is offering expedition cruises in Antarctica and South America through March.

The Carnival Corporation-owned upscale brand is also offering a full world cruise itinerary, in addition to itineraries in the Caribbean, Asia, Australia and more.

Cruise Industry News breaks down the company’s itineraries for the 2022-2023 season:

Antarctica

Seabourn Venture
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 264 guests
Built: 2022
Homeport: Ushuaia (Argentina)
Length: 10 to 20 nights
Itineraries: Expeditions to Antarctic Peninsula and other remote destinations in the region, including South Georgia, the Falklands and more
Sailing Season: November 25 to March 17

Caribbean and South America

Seabourn Ovation
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 604 guests
Built: 2018
Homeports: Bridgetown (Barbados); and Philipsburg (St. Maarten)
Length: Seven to 11 nights
Itineraries: Southern and Eastern Caribbean sailing to several destinations, including Guadeloupe, Martinique, Grenadines, St. Kitts, Antigua and more
Sailing Season: December 10 to March 18

Seabourn Quest
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 450 guests
Built: 2011
Homeports: Miami (United States); Buenos Aires (Argentina); Rio de Janeiro and Manaus (Brazil); San Antonio (Chile); and more
Length: 13 to 25 nights
Itineraries: Caribbean and Panama Canal in December, followed by a three-month program in South America that includes visits to Patagonia, the Inca Coast, Brazil and the Amazon
Sailing Season: November 11 to March 26

Asia

Seabourn Encore
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 604 guests
Built: 2016
Homeports: Singapore; and Dubai (UAE)
Length: 14 to 17 nights
Itineraries: Southeast Asia visiting Thailand, Cambodia, Vietnam, Philippines, Malaysia and more, as well as repositioning cruises sailing through Asia and the Middle East
Sailing Season: December 7 to March 19

World Cruise

Seabourn Sojourn
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 450 guests
Built: 2010
Homeports: Miami (United States) to Barcelona (Spain)
Length: 140 nights
Itineraries: Global circumnavigation visiting several ports in Central America, the South Pacific, Australia and New Zealand, the Indian Ocean and Africa
Sailing Season: January 6 to May 27

Australia and South Pacific

Seabourn Odyssey
Capacity (at 100% Occupancy): 450 guests
Built: 2009
Homeports: Sydney (Australia); Auckland (New Zealand); and Papeete (Tahiti)
Length: 12 to 16 nights
Itineraries: Southern Australia and New Zealand with visits to Philip Island, Steward Island, Timaru and Picton, in addition to Queensland, South Pacific and the French Polynesia in March and April
Sailing Season: December 5 to April 15
